As part of the commemoration of the national month, the Colombian Aerospace Force, through the Air Combat Command No. 7, CACOM 7, and its Comprehensive Action Section and in coordination with the municipal mayor's office of Cerrito, Valle de Cauca department, an outreach activity was carried out with the inhabitants, reaffirming their commitment to the wellbeing of the most vulnerable communities and the strengthening of the social fabric.
During the activity, 2,400 diapers for children and 30 boxes of spaghetti were distributed, humanitarian aid that benefited 92 people, especially families with children in early childhood. This initiative managed to provide timely support to those who need it most, contributing to the improvement of their quality of life by providing essential elements for the care and development of minors.
